US pharmaceutical company Par Health Inc announced on Friday the launch of its generic version of Merck's Janumet XR (sitagliptin and metformin HCl extended-release) tablets for oral use, following final approval from the US Food and Drug Administration (FDA) of its Abbreviated New Drug Application.
Par Health's sitagliptin metformin XR is the first and currently the only FDA-approved generic of Janumet XR available in the United States. According to IQVIA data, Janumet XR had estimated annual US sales of approximately USD269.9m for the 12 months ended May 2026.
Janumet XR is a registered trademark of Merck Sharp & Dohme LLC.
